Synopsis

This easy to understand, do-it-yourself text fully assists the student or practitioner in conducting research to develop solutions to accounting or auditing questions. Used by numerous universities and public accounting firms, this text guides readers through the research process in a step-by-step manner. Weirich is intended for the undergraduate or graduate accounting or auditing research course taught at most four-year universities. There is also be substantial carry-over into the professional marketplace.

About the Author

Alan Reinstein DBA CPA received his B.A. and M.S. degrees from the State University of New York (New Paltz) an M.B.A. degree form the University of Detroit and a Doctorate in Accounting form the University of Kentucky. He is aProfessor in the Department of Accounting School of Business at Wayne State University. Professor Reinstein conducts many seminars for the AICPA MACPA may other state CPA societies and professional groups. An author of more than 100 articles Dr. Reinstein serves on the editorial boards of several academic and professional journals and on the boards of the Michigan Associations of CPAs and the Detroit Chapters of the Institute fi Internal Auditors and the National Associations of Accountants. He also chaired the Professional Examination Committee of the American Accounting Association and served on the Task Force on Professional Examinations and Regulations of the Accounting Education Change Commission. Formerly with an international CPA firm he now functions as a research and educational consultant for many CPAs and attorneys.
